      Issue Summary

      The issue can only happen if the draft is first created, then closed immediately after the editor is saying saved. The call to synchronize the draft hasn't actually been done yet but since the editor is showing that the draft has been saved, this may cause confusion with the users.

      Steps to Reproduce

      1. Go to a Confluence space
      2. Create a new page
      3. Give it a title and some content
      4. After the editor's status on the top right says saved, immediately close the editor

      Expected Results

      Since the editor is showing saved, the draft should be saved

      Actual Results

      The draft is not being saved and is lost

      Workaround

      Wait for a few seconds before closing the editor.
